Effective Medium Theory (EMT) and Composite Materials
For materials composed of inclusions within a host matrix, such as ceramic nanoparticles embedded in a polymer host, the bulk refractive index ($n_{\text{eff}}$) is often modeled using EMT approximations, such as the Maxwell-Garnett model.
